Summary
This study presents a simplified arthroscopic suprapectoral approach for biceps tenodesis, a procedure to treat shoulder pain caused by the long head of the biceps tendon. The technique aims to improve outcomes and reduce complications.

Background:
- The long head of the biceps (LHB) tendon is a frequent source of shoulder pain.
- Biceps tenodesis is a common surgical procedure for addressing LHB tendon and superior labrum issues, aiming to alleviate pain and restore shoulder function.
- Current literature lacks consensus on the optimal technique and approach for superior outcomes in biceps tenodesis.
Purpose of the Study:
- To present a novel, simplified arthroscopic suprapectoral approach for biceps tenodesis.
- To describe a technique utilizing standard arthroscopic portals for LHB tendon release and suture anchor fixation.
- To aim for maximized patient outcomes and minimized complications associated with biceps tenodesis.
Main Methods:
- An arthroscopic suprapectoral approach was utilized.
- The long head of the biceps tendon was released from the bicipital groove.
- Fixation was achieved using a suture anchor through standard arthroscopic portals.
Main Results:
- The described technique simplifies the surgical procedure for biceps tenodesis.
- This approach facilitates performance through standard arthroscopic portals.
- The technique is designed to enhance outcomes and mitigate common complications.
Conclusions:
- The presented arthroscopic suprapectoral biceps tenodesis technique offers a simplified and effective method for managing LHB tendon pathology.
- This approach has the potential to improve patient outcomes and reduce the incidence of complications.
- Further studies may be warranted to compare this technique with other established methods.
